  Pioneer DJ just released an update to its Rekordbox software. Now at version 5.0.2, it brings compatibility to Apple’s latest macOS High Sierra operating system. A raft of minor tweaks accompanies it, along with bug fixes related to Interface 2, the DDJ-RZX, and the XDJ-RX. macOS High Sierra support in Rekordbox 5.0.2 means that Mac users can [...]
